How to Apply for Student Housing
Housing placement is on a first-come, first-served basis and is not guaranteed. We encourage students to apply early. Students applying for housing might be placed on a waitlist, depending on demand and the number of applications received. Please follow the instructions below for completing your student housing application. If you have questions, please view our Frequently Asked Questions page for more information.
- Apply to Lake Tahoe Community College
Complete your LTCC application at cccapply.com (You may begin applying for Fall 2025 on February 1.) - Activate Self-Service Portal
Once your application has been accepted and processed, you will receive an email titled "Welcome Message from LTCC." This message will provide instructions for activating your student portal account. Please read these directions carefully and make sure that you create a new password for your account as well as completing the directions for setting up the MFA (multifactor authentication) using Microsoft Single Sign-on. (This is an app you will need to download to your portable device.)- Note: All communcations about student housing will come through the self-service student portal and your LTCC email. We do not recommend forwarding these emails to your personal account as this does not always work correctly.
- Wait 24 Hours
Once you are able to sign in successfully to your student portal and email account, wait at least 24 hours for your account to be updated in the school's housing portal. - Login To Student Housing Portal
Login to the housing application portal at ltcc.erezlife.com and follow the prompts to complete an application for Fall 2025. Students must submit a security deposit fee of $500 to confirm and secure their reservation in any college-sponsored housing assignment. Financial Aid can help to cover this fee. - Apply For Financial Aid
Finally, if you have not done so already, make sure that you complete and submit the 2025-2026 FAFSA financial aid application, which will be used to determine your eligibility for housing.
